Sarah Ellen Stafford was born in 1901 in North Carolina, the child of George Newton Stafford and Mary Angelina McPherson. Sarah Ellen Stafford later married Lonnie Albert Thompson, and together they raised children including Rachel Ione Thompson, Albert Newton Thompson, John Sabert Thompson, Elmer Thompson, Dorothy Thompson and Julian Thompson. In 1975, Sarah Ellen Stafford passed away in Burlington, Alamance, North Carolina.
